你可以不精通Vue,但一定要精通JS!
有人说,程序员是最苦逼的职业,因为掌握的是门技术,而不像律师或是医生,能掌握一门手艺。手艺可以弥久而精,越老越值钱,但做技术如果不能顺应潮流,时时更新,就将面临被淘汰的风险。
这一点在前端行业最为明显,前端刚兴起的时候,只要会HTML+CSS+JavaScript,就能在阿里、腾讯这样的大厂找到工作,但现在随便翻看岗位JD,动不动就是要求熟练掌握React/Vue,熟悉Element、Echarts,熟悉Node.js。每年的需求都在向更深、更新在变化。
而在最近的新闻里,7月Vue刚公布到了RC版本,风头有要压过React的趋势,8月,微软又推出了TypeScript4.0,这些都说明了前端技术仍然处于加速变化的阶段。
那么,会不会有一天,就像许许多多已经没落的编程语言一样,JavaScript也会被进化过的编程语言替代?这样的话,我们还有没有必要不断的深入学习JS?
其实这种担忧没有任何意义。虽然我们无法准确预知未来,但在可见的时间里,JS都将会是前端最重要的底层技能。因为与框架不同,JS对于前端的重要性,可以与数学知识对物理研究的贡献相比,对JS的掌握程度,一直都在决定着前端开发者的求职上限。
在如今这个5G时代里,前端的技术迭代只会越来越快,现有的框架很可能在不久后就面临着过时,只有牢牢把握住JS这一前端技术的基石,才能以不变应万变,时刻保证自身具有高竞争力。
为了帮大家更加深入掌握JS技能,这里分享一套限时0元课程——《JavaScript系列课程》
课程官方原价699元,涵盖四大模块:
1.“this指向”
2.“基于防抖和节流的性能优化”
3.“数据响应式原理剖析”
4.“基于Web Component的组件化开发”
是你前所未见的超值!有需要的小伙伴抓紧免费领取吧!
限时0元 免费领取
100个优惠名额 先到先得
01
"变幻莫测"的this指向
this指向与面向对象是前端面试“高频问题”,也是日常开发中绕不开的话题,很多前端老鸟也会在this指向这里掉坑。本节课围绕this指向问题,通过《LOL游戏》案例的编写,去分析this在不同环境下的不同指向。
技术点:
·箭头函数 ·call/apply/bind ·this
·Object-Oriented Programming
你将收获:
1、透彻认识function的this在不同调用环境下的指向
2、了解箭头函数中的this指向的特殊性
3、掌握如何改变this指向
02
基于防抖和节流的性能优化
当下网页中的交互越来越多,很多高频事件带来的性能问题,已经是绕不过去的一个坎。怎么去优化这些高频事件呢?防抖和节流就必不可少。本节课从实际应用出发,帮大家掌握防抖与节流的使用。
技术点:
·debounce ·throttle
你将收获:
1、了解防抖与节流的概念
2、掌握手写防抖函数与节流函数
3、掌握基于防抖与节流的性能优化
03
数据响应式原理剖析
我们正生活在一个“数据为王”的时代,数据在实际开发中的应用,重要性不言而喻。这节课围绕《LOL游戏》案例中的问题,来探究数据响应式的实现原理。
技术点:
·Object.defineProperty ·set/get ·Proxy
你将收获:
1、Proxy代理与数据劫持
2、掌握Vue中的数据响应式实现
3、掌握Vue中双向绑定实现
04
基于Web Component的组件化开发
想知道各种UI框架的组件是怎么来的么?
想让页面保持干净整洁,让我们只关注整体的逻辑么?
想知道多人协作开发该如何进行么?
本节课中将会围绕这些话题去优化代码,去抽离我们的逻辑,从此告别重复造轮子。
技术点:
·Object.assagin ·customElements.define
你将收获:
1、了解组件化开发的必要性
2、知道到底什么是组件
3、通过继承拓展组件功能
4、Web Component自定义组件
JavaScript系列课程
限时0元 免费领取
100个优惠名额 先到先得
你可以不精通Vue,但一定要精通JS!相关推荐
- VUE 响应式原理源码:带你一步精通 VUE | 原力计划
作者 | 爱编程的小和尚 责编 | 王晓曼 出品 | CSDN博客 学过 VUE 如果不了解响应式的原理,怎么能说自己熟练使用 VUE,要是没有写过一个简易版的 VUE 怎么能说自己精通 VUE,这篇 ...
- 视频教程-新React+VUE前端教程入门到精通-Vue
新React+VUE前端教程入门到精通 10年以上开发经验,曾经是八维教育实训主任,千峰教育高级HTML5前端讲师,尚品中国创始人.现任程序思维创始人.曾和大厂.国企等大型企业合作开发项目.百余客户, ...
- 【三十天精通 Vue 3】 专栏内容介绍
全网最火Vue3专栏 6月5日开始更新Vue3源码解析 在这个专栏中,我们将带你深入了解 Vue 3 的各个方面.首先,我们将带你了解 Vue 3 的新特性和改进,包括 Composition API ...
- 视频教程-vue从入门到精通-Vue
vue从入门到精通 软通动力教育集团简称软通大学,依托软通动力在技术服务领域的多方位解决方案能力,采用先进的教学理念和模式,直通高校和城市,开展干部培养,文化落地,初级资源培训,培训需求对接,专业项目 ...
- 视频教程-Vue零基础到精通视频教程-Vue
Vue零基础到精通视频教程 从事多年web前端开发和教育培训(线上)工作,主要从事web前端工作.php后端工作,在pc端和移动端开发都具有丰富经验,同事有响应式布局.vue框架开发.微信小程序开发经 ...
- vue 数组 指定位置添加数据_VUE 响应式原理源码:带你一步精通 VUE | 原力计划...
作者 | 爱编程的小和尚 责编 | 王晓曼 出品 | CSDN博客 学过 VUE 如果不了解响应式的原理,怎么能说自己熟练使用 VUE,要是没有写过一个简易版的 VUE 怎么能说自己精通 VUE,这篇 ...
- 1. Vue从入门到精通(第一章 vue核心)
Vue从入门到精通(第一章 vue核心) 第一章 Vue核心 1. Vue简介 1.1 Vue是什么? 1.2 Vue的作者以及迭代版本 1.3 Vue的特点 2. 搭建Vue开发环境 2.1 安装V ...
- js字符串替换_浅析Vue的生命周期以及JS异步
前言 Vue的生命周期和JS异步都是有很多文章的知识点,我之前也是一知半解,基本够用. 但是直到我在开发的时候真的遇到了问题,才发现如果不把这些知识点融汇到一起,很难解决实际问题. 我甚至觉得这是我离 ...
- Vue 脚手架中的.eslintrc.js代码规范 的解决
在我们使用Vue脚手架 创建项目时 尤其是团队共同开发项目时 会按照一个共同的代码规范来编程 创建Vue脚手架中有一个.eslintrc.js格式 但是在编程中我们通常会使用 shift+alt+f ...
- Vue报错:sockjs.js?9be2:1627 GET http://192.168.43.88:8080/sockjs-node/info?t=1631603986586 net::ERR_CO
Vue报错:sockjs.js?9be2:1627 GET http://192.168.43.88:8080/sockjs-node/info?t=1631603986586 net::ERR_CO ...
最新文章
- 计算机中英语GAI缩写,等等英语_英语中“等等”缩写成为etc吗要加一点吗全拼是什么谢谢大家_淘题吧...
- Excel批量导入数据库
- 冷板式液冷--液冷服务器(6-2)
- 如何提高网站收录及排名的方法
- Django(part53)--404模板文件
- 201609-5 祭坛
- std::atomic和std::mutex区别
- 修改oracle的表空间文件scn,分享:bbed修改数据文件头推进scn与其他数据文件相同...
- 敏捷开发免费管理工具——火星人预览之五:常见问题问答
- java当前类路径_java获取当前类的绝对路径
- shell脚本如何获取当前时间
- 2020年最新测绘规范目录(可下载在线查看相关规范)
- 宝塔面板安装云锁启用拦截功能全流程操作
- android web 爬虫,Android学习——Jsoup实现网络爬虫,爬取贤集网
- Python爬虫爬取纵横中文网小说
- java实现统计pv和uv_shell统计pv与uv、独立ip的方法
- 本地搭建Agriculture_KnowledgeGraph农业知识图谱环境时遇到的问题及解决办法
- 微信模板消息推送接口说明
- 学习mathematica(三)——基本数学运算
- 12月小红书彩妆、护肤类KOL影响力视频图文排行榜
热门文章
- QT_C++08-Qt实战-QQ聊天
- 计算机术语中Cache代表缓存,2012年3月计算机一级MsOffice选择题精选及答案详解(第六套)...
- 安卓国际化(多语言切换),支持小语种
- hybird app(混合式app开发)cordova ionic 创建相应平台的app
- 面部识别技术帮助警察监控和跟踪嫌疑人
- BIV+CSS网页的标准化布局
- 云顶之弈法机器人_《云顶之弈》机器人阵容怎么玩 快乐机器人攻略分享_18183云顶之弈专区...
- 宝城高丽——韩国料理
- Win10系统盘安装系统流程
- 大学学习编程的一点小建议